Item 2.01.    Completion of Acquisition or Disposition of Assets.
 
On October 21, 2019, BayCom Corp, a California corporation (“BayCom”) completed its previously announced acquisition of TIG Bancorp (“TIG”) pursuant to an Agreement and Plan of Merger, dated June 28, 2019 (the “Merger Agreement”), by and between BayCom and TIG.  Under the terms of the Merger Agreement, TIG merged with and into BayCom (the “Merger”), with BayCom as the surviving corporation in the Merger. Immediately following the Merger, First State Bank of Colorado, a wholly-owned subsidiary of TIG, merged with and into United Business Bank, a wholly-owned subsidiary of BayCom (the “Bank Merger”), with United Business Bank as the surviving bank in the Bank Merger.

Pursuant to the Merger Agreement, at the effective time of the Merger (the “Effective Time”), BayCom paid aggregate consideration to TIG shareholders of approximately 876,803 shares of BayCom common stock and $20.2 million in cash.  Each share of common stock of TIG outstanding immediately prior to the Effective Time, excluding certain specified shares including any dissenting shares, converted into the right to receive 0.27543 of a share of BayCom common stock and $6.34 per share in cash.

BAYCOM CORP COMPLETES ACQUISITION
OF TIG BANCORP





WALNUT CREEK, California, October 22, 2019 – BayCom Corp (NASDAQ: BCML) (“BayCom” or the “Company”), the parent company of United Business Bank, today announced that effective October 21, 2019, it completed its acquisition of TIG Bancorp (“TIG”), headquartered in Greenwood Village, Colorado and the merger of First State Bank of Colorado, TIG’s wholly owned bank subsidiary, into United Business Bank.  Under the terms of the merger agreement, TIG shareholders will receive 0.27543 of a share of BayCom common stock and $6.34 in cash in exchange for each share of TIG common stock, with cash to be paid in lieu of any fractional shares. The cash and stock transaction is valued at approximately $39.9 million or $12.53 per share in the aggregate based on BayCom’s closing stock price as of October 21, 2019.   TIG shareholders will receive information shortly on how to exchange their TIG shares for BayCom shares.

“We at TIG Bancorp are pleased and excited about becoming a part of BayCom and having the advantage of their size, number of branches, and diverse package of products and services to offer our clients.  The merger has already had a very positive effect on the value of our shareholders’ investment.” said Gary Webb, Chairman of the Board and co-founder, along with Boyd Hodges, of TIG Bancorp.

George Guarini, President and Chief Executive Officer of BayCom, said: “We are extremely pleased and proud to be able to announce the consummation of this acquisition. It marks the third acquisition since completing our IPO in May 2018.  We are very excited to be entering the Colorado market and setting the stage for taking advantage of additional partner opportunities available in the state.  As a result of this acquisition, we now have assets totaling approximately $2.0 billion, 32 branch locations and a capital base of more than $257.0 million.”

Guarini further stated, “We welcome the clients, employees and shareholders of the former TIG Bancorp and First State Bank of Colorado and look forward to continuing to make the United Business Bank story one that we are proud of.”

About BayCom Corp
BayCom, through its wholly owned operating subsidiary, United Business Bank, offers a full-range of loans, including SBA, FSA and USDA guaranteed loans, and deposit products and services to businesses and its affiliates in California, Washington, New Mexico and Colorado.  United Business Bank also offers business escrow services and facilitates tax free exchanges through its Bankers Exchange Division.  United Business Bank is an Equal Housing Lender and a member of FDIC.  BayCom Corp is traded on the NASDAQ under the symbol “BCML”.  For more information, go to www.unitedbusinessbank.com.
